AFTER consecutive years of high growth, auto part manufacturers are about to witness a period of consolidation. The Malaysia Automotive Association (MAA) expects a 3.5 per cent growth in sales to 450,000.
However, vehicle sales for January 2003 indicate flat growth year-on-year and thus, industry players as well as industry observers have taken a conservative view. But, most remain optimistic about the long-term prospects of the industry.
